Where to Watch Eagles Game in Philly: Best Spots & Streaming Guide

For fans in Philadelphia, catching the energy of a live Eagles game is a core part of the city’s identity. Whether you are a lifelong supporter or a visitor experiencing the passion for the first time, knowing where to watch Eagles game in Philly ensures you never miss a moment. This guide details the primary locations, broadcast specifics, and the atmosphere that makes each viewing option unique.

Linc Energy Stadium: The Heart of the Action

The most direct way to watch Eagles game in Philly is, of course, at the source: Lincoln Financial Field. Being inside the stadium is an experience that transcends watching on a screen, with the roar of the crowd and the sheer scale of the venue creating an unforgettable atmosphere. However, tickets can be expensive and hard to come by for marquee matchups.

Stadium Atmosphere and Logistics

When you watch Eagles game at Linc, you are stepping into the epicenter of NFL passion. The stadium is located in South Philadelphia, easily accessible via public transit, rideshare, or personal vehicle. Tailgating is a massive part of the culture, with fans gathering in the parking lots for hours before kickoff to grill, socialize, and build excitement.

Watching from Home: Network and Streaming Options

Most fans choose to watch Eagles game from the comfort of their living rooms, and there are several reliable methods to do so. The specific network depends on the opponent and the time of day, but the games are typically broadcast on major national networks like Fox and NBC, or regional networks like CBS for interconference games.

Cable and Antenna Options

For traditional cable subscribers, channels such as Fox, NBC, and CBS are the standard homes for Eagles broadcasts. You do not need a satellite subscription to access these channels, as an over-the-air antenna can pick up the local signals clearly, provided you are within range of the broadcast towers.

Streaming has become the preferred method for cord-cutters who still want to watch Eagles game on their schedule. Services like Peacock hold the exclusive rights to Sunday Night Football games, making it the primary destination for weekly action. Additionally, Fox, CBS, and NBC offer their own streaming apps.

Maximizing Your Streaming Experience

To watch Eagles game via streaming, you will need a robust internet connection and a subscription to the relevant service. The official team app is also invaluable, providing live scores, video highlights, and breaking news directly to your phone. Many providers offer mobile data caps, so it is wise to connect to Wi-Fi during the game to ensure smooth playback.

If you prefer the communal energy of a bar but cannot make it to the stadium, Philadelphia has no shortage of establishments eager to host Eagles fans. These venues know how to create the perfect environment, with large screens, enthusiastic crowds, and themed decorations that amplify the excitement of the game.

Finding the Right Atmosphere

Whether you watch Eagles game at a historic pub in South Philly, a modern sports bar in Center City, or a cozy neighborhood tavern, the vibe is usually electric. Look for places that emphasize the broadcast quality and the food, as these factors significantly impact the overall enjoyment of the event.

Radio Broadcasts: The Sound of the Game

Radio remains a vital medium for Eagles fans, particularly for those on the go or who prefer a more auditory experience. The flagship station provides play-by-play commentary that captures the intensity of every snap. Listening to the game on the radio allows your imagination to fill in the gaps, creating a personal connection to the action.
